从导入的模块调试 python 函数调用

vbfh

我想知道当我使用类似于以下代码的 scikit learn 库运行交叉验证时调用了哪些函数:

scores = cross_val_score(estimator=clf,
                             X=X_train,
                             y=y_train,
                             cv=10,
                             scoring='roc_auc')

特别是,我想了解在 scikit learn 中调用了什么 predict 函数。

哈萨

您可以使用检查模块

# import required modules
import inspect
  
def fun(a,b):
    # product of 
    # two numbers
    return a*b
  
# use getsource()
print(inspect.getsource(fun))

输出如下

def fun(a,b): 两个数的乘积返回 a*b

来源:https : //www.geeksforgeeks.org/inspect-module-in-python/

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

Python:从导入的文件调用函数

从Python模块导入隐藏函数

如何仅通过导入模块就可以调用 python 模块函数

Python返回fixture而不是调用导入的函数

如果我调用其他文件的函数,则导入相同的python模块

Python:哪个导入模块正在运行时调用我的函数

无法调用动态导入的python模块

Python并发。将多次调用导入的模块

从导入模块中的父模块调用函数

Python从导入的模块中模拟函数

Python从导入的模块中模拟函数

在Python中导入模块时运行函数

如何限制可以从导入的模块调用哪些函数?我可以将函数设为私有吗?(Python)

Python从模块两次导入函数,内部导入不同

在C ++中嵌入Python:在python脚本中导入模块在一个函数调用期间起作用,而在另一函数调用时不起作用

从导入模块重新定义调用的函数

模拟导入模块时调用的函数

Python调试:获取调用函数的文件名和行号?

在PyCharm中调试Python时获取函数调用的临时结果

从函数python调用函数

从模块中导入函数的Python导入错误(ModuleNotFoundError),该模块从另一个模块中导入类

在函数调用中使用Python 3+导入包?

如何在Jinja模板中导入和调用Python函数?

在Python中,我可以调用导入模块的main()吗?

使用python3和nltk从模块调用函数的问题

Python:如何使用字典调用模块中的函数?

在Python中调用模块函数时遇到问题?

在Python中获取调用函数模块的__name__

Tkinter Python:调用函数时找不到模块吗?